All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/mi/mifi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Nan Wheaton wheaton1624@yahoo.com July 4, 2018, 7:48 pm Sentinel-Standard - Tuesday May 17, 1977 Belding - Lloyd B. Davison, of 607 Root street, died at Belding Community hospital Monday afternoon. Mr. Davison was a member of the Lesky-Dulek chapter 29 of Disabled American Veterans in Fremont and was retired from the Army Air Force having served in the Korean and Viet Nam conflicts. Mr. Davison lived in the Newaygo and Hardy Dam area before moving to Belding. Survivors include two daughters Mrs. Thomas (Florence) Goeree of Belding, and Mrs. Denis (Frances) Marsh of Belding, three sons, Lloyd L. with the Navy in Pensacola, William of Biloxi, Mississippi and Robert A. of Pierson; three sisters, Mrs. Lawrence (Florence) Longuski of Ubly, Mrs. Genevieve Kellogg of Belding and Mrs. Stanley (Margaret) Thomas of Newaygo, four brothers, Marvin of Holton, John of Belding, Elmo of California and David of Hawaii and eight grandchildren. Services are Thursday at 11 am from the Charles M. Courser funeral home in Belding with Rev. Eugene A. Lewis officiating. Additional service and burial are Thursday at 3 pm in Stearns cemetery near Croton. The family will receive friends and relatives at the funeral home Tuesday 7 to 8:30 pm and Wednesday 2 to 4 and 7 to 8:30 pm. Additional Comments: Age: 49 Burial: Thursday 19 May 1977 S.S. b.
